Real Estate Lead, Americas
Apple is a company known for its innovative products and commitment to diversity. They are seeking a Senior Real Estate Manager to oversee retail leasing, portfolio management, and to drive the Global Real Estate strategy while maintaining strong relationships with landlords and managing complex real estate transactions.

Responsibilities
Leadership and management to develop, negotiate and implement complex real estate transactions, negotiate new and existing lease agreements, as well as secure internal approvals by working cross-functionally to solve and bring closure to complex issues within capital plan
Source opportunities, analyze locations and market information, build business models with financial sensitivities, provide feasibility options and business justifications, and recommend the best options for optimal market performance and brand impact
Drive project life cycle through lease execution and landlord delivery. Responsible to align and collaborate cross functionally with a diverse group of partners and present projects to leadership
Proactively manage real estate portfolio by tracking and reporting on upcoming lease events, critical project milestone dates and other initiatives that require real estate involvement to deliver. Foster and maintain excellent relationships with landlords, developers, and other retailers
Qualification
Required
7+ years of experience in retail real estate or development work with a solid understanding of design, development and construction processes for tenant build-out
Ability to work cross-functionally with internal and external partners to drive and deliver real estate planning
Extensive expertise in negotiations, lease contracts, financial modeling, project management, lease optimization, issue resolution, planning, reporting
Skilled in planning, tracking, evaluating and reporting on work and deliverables
Experience handling internal approval processes, alignment among internal teams and managing external partners
Strong financial, analytical, and leasing experience
Elevated written and verbal communication as well as presentation skills
Ability to travel extensively
Bachelor's degree required
Preferred
15+ years of experience in retail real estate or development work
Comfort negotiating with C-Suite representatives of Landlords and other partners
Energetic and flexible; motivated and able to work in fast and dynamic organization
Can work independently and as part of a team
MBA or higher degree preferred
